The Kingdom of Saudi Arabia has achieved a significant global milestone in the palm and dates sector, ranking first worldwide in date exports by value for the year 2021, according to international trade reports.
The Kingdom recorded the highest global annual growth rate in date exports, reaching 13% over the past five years, reflecting a steady and growing demand for Saudi dates in global markets.
In 2021, the total value of Saudi date exports reached SAR 1.215 billion, marking an increase of 110% compared to previous years. This underscores the substantial progress made in developing this strategic agricultural sector.
Saudi dates were exported to 113 countries worldwide, highlighting their high quality and strong competitiveness in international markets. This growth has been supported by the integrated efforts of the National Center for Palms and Dates, in cooperation with government entities and the private sector, and aligns with the goals of Saudi Vision 2030 to enhance non-oil exports.
The National Center for Palms and Dates continues to implement programs and initiatives that improve the value chain of the date sector, increase global recognition of Saudi products, and strengthen their presence in international markets as a model of high-quality and safe food products.
